### Account Recovery — Catalogue Import (Lintwood)

Quick one for review: when the Lintwood catalogue import wipes a patron's session table, the recovery flow re-seeds accounts from the nightly snapshot. Check that the importer skips locked accounts — last time it didn't. To rerun recovery against staging you'll need the vault passphrase, which is appended just below.

recovery phrase for yafof-tajof: julmir-kelax-julvan-holath-belvan-holir-ralael-ralvan-ralath-julvan-silmir-istmir-kaswyn-ulamir

# Artifact Signing — Remindery Clinic Job

The nightly appointment reminder job ships as a signed container. CI signs on merge to main; no manual signing in normal flow. If CI is down and the clinic batch must run, build locally, sign, and push to the internal registry. Verification happens at pull time; unsigned images are rejected. Rotate quarterly. For the emergency manual path, use the deploy key below.

deploy key for kajof-fajop: bky6_gDHw9Q

## Releases

The Copperline metrics-aggregation sidecar follows a monthly release cadence, with hotfixes as needed. Each release is published to the Varnwell registry as a signed container image plus a checksum manifest. Support staff triaging customer deployments should always confirm the image signature before advising an upgrade — unsigned or mismatched images indicate a corrupted mirror, not a Copperline bug, and should be escalated to the build team. Signature verification requires the current release signing key, which follows.

release key, fajef-kajeg: bky19_LdLu6Ne6FLi8he2c24d

## Onboarding: Pellwright Queue-Depth Autoscaler

The autoscaler watches the depth of the ingest queue and adds or removes worker pods every thirty seconds. Support folks mostly interact with it when customers report slow processing: check the `pellctl status` output first, since nine times out of ten the queue is draining normally. Scaling decisions are logged to the Birchmoor dashboard. If you ever rebuild a worker locally, the autoscaler agent needs to authenticate to the control plane, which means your env file must include:

env line for fafof-fahag: LEDGER_TOKEN5=f8790